Washroom flooring
Attempt to prevent need to place carpetings on the restroom flooring, according to the survey it is not as well favoured. The study showed that the recommended flooring covering was ceramic tiles, with 75 per cent claiming they "liked" a tiled restroom flooring. Popular vinyl floor covering has not yet shed its location in the bathroom, with greater than 61 per cent stating they didn't have any type of strong sort or disapproval towards it.
When picking your shower room flooring, ceramic tiles is the favoured choice, yet if the budget plan is limited, after that vinyl flooring won't let you down.
Apart from the floor covering, make certain your windows look appealing. When it pertains to clothing your shower room windows, stay away from those shower room webs as well as fabric drapes. The survey revealed that 94 percent claimed they favoured blinds in the shower room to curtains.
Shower power
When intending the design of your washroom, one of the most crucial aspects to take into consideration is placing a shower. Some washrooms don't have adequate room to include a shower work area, so examine your options. Take into consideration installing a shower over the bathroom if space is restricted.
The survey revealed that 94 percent of its participants thought that a shower in a shower room was very essential, and also 81 percent stated they chose a separate shower enclosure in a large bathroom. Almost 65 percent claimed their suitable would be a power shower, while 27 percent chosen mixer showers, and also only 12 percent chose electrical showers.
If you have picked a shower over the bath, after that consider placing a fixed glass screen rather than a shower curtain. It might cost a couple of extra pounds, yet more than half of the survey's factors favored a fixed glass display to a shower drape.
Picking your bath tub
Contrary to usual belief, including a whirlpool bath to increase property worth doesn't always suffice. So if you're contemplating marketing your residential or commercial property, attempt to avoid purchasing a whirlpool bath in the hopes of getting additional revenue.
The study revealed that close to 53 per cent of its individuals were not phased by them, while just a small 38 per cent of participants "enjoyed" them. Remarkably, 62 percent said they had "no strong sight" in the direction of edge bathrooms either, which means the conventional rectangle-shaped baths still hold influence versus their spruced up counter parts.
Hi simpleness
From as far back as the 1960s much emphasis was placed on vibrant colour in the bathroom. Patterned wall surface floor tiles of nautical creatures as well as outrageous colours were the trend, together with plastic. Plastic shower room decor was the craze, from bold orange, olive eco-friendly, mustard yellow and also chocolate brownish coloured toothbrush, soap and towel holders, to thick formed plastic shower drapes that howled colours of the boldest nature.
As the times went on, the 1970s and also early 1980s became a period when gold bathroom fixings and providing, such as faucets, towel rails and toilet roll holders, were thought about really fashionable. These ostentatious gold trimmed functions were popular, and also washroom decor was 'loud'. Added to this were those when fascinating bathroom suites in colours avocado, coral reefs pink, and also delicious chocolate brownish. Bathroom colour has transformed substantially over the past decade, and tones have actually become much more neutral, occasionally with a tip of colour that adds a complementary vigour to the total scheme.
Of the many numerous individuals that participated in Plumbworld's recent shower room study, an overwhelming 82 per cent claimed they "despised" the once glorified avocado as well as coral reefs pink washroom suites, colours remnant of 1970s as well as 1980s, which are typically characterised as being dark as well as boring.
According to the study, chrome bathroom taps were much chosen to gold.
So, when creating and also enhancing your washroom keep those dark colours at bay, think about white suites, and opt for chrome fixings and also furnishings instead of flashy gold.

How To Design Small Bathrooms
few months ago I wrote a blog on how to design a general perfect bathroom. So continuing from that let’s have a look now on how to design small bathrooms. As let’s be honest here, how many of you have got a big or a good size bathroom in your home? Well, I guess not many, and as matter of fact, many of the bathrooms in an average house are quite small. When we design our client’ bathrooms we always find many challenges to take in consideration and issue to solve. So let’s consider some design tips that can help you to make the most of your space without compromising on the essential but still give the illusion of spaciousness!
The secret of how to design small bathroom is all in the planning, and the smallest space the more this needs to be well thought. Hence prioritise what is most important to you. Don’t forget about the negative space that you need around you in order to move and not having to hit another piece of furniture or object. That will hand up in screaming and frustration every time that you will use the bathroom! So consider well where you are going to position your basin, toilet and bath or shower and think that with these will follow also accessories and they need to be taken into consideration in terms of space too.
Tiles, units & brassware
Be smart when you choose your tiles. Try and select large, plain tiles for the wall for instance with a different colour version of the flooring. If you can, avoid too many patterns. If you do choose patterns do only or for the walls or the floor and not both as this will make the space feel cramped.
Try and clear the floor as much as you can. Therefore, if you want to make the room feel bigger opt for wall-mounted units. These are handy also when it comes to cleaning – always think at the practical side too!
Also, choosing the right brassware can make a difference in terms of spatial illusion. In fact, wall-mounted taps and shower mixer with a concealed body are a nice way for reducing the visual clutter and making the space feel larger.
Storage
Always a big issue when it comes to bathroom and one aspect that people often forget. You look at the beautiful pictures on Pinterest or magazine where there is just one small bottle on display. In reality, doesn’t really work like this. You all are going to have toilet paper packs, shower gel, soap bottles and a lot of more stuff that you need for your everyday use. Thus when planning your bathroom think form the start how you can create the extra space and plan ahead for fitted niches or conceal cupboards withing stud walls. Also try and get vanity unit with drawers or cabinet that are quite spacious where you can put things and not only look pretty!
When it comes to heating underfloor heating is a good solution and space efficient. Or use towel rails, which can also be used for heating too.
If you are a bath person and not having the right space for a full-size tub why don’t consider Bijou style baths that usually are smaller in length and also so pretty!
When it comes to saving space people don’t consider doors. Using sliding or pocket doors can be a good free up layout option. Or if you still want to keep the standard door, then make sure that you hang it so the swing is outside the room!
Last but not least don’t forget of course to add a good size mirror. This is the most simple trick for creating the illusion of more space and also can help to spread the lights around.
